Millions of people have dreamed, at one time or another, of launching their own home-based business, and of the incredible opportunities it can provide. The benefits of time flexibility and control over your destiny is a major draw. Taking it from this idea to a functioning plan is another story, and can be helped through the following tips.

Back up important documents pertaining to your business with removable storage. This could save you thousands in expenses and preserve your reputation as a business. You can utilize an online storage service as a backup solution for your data as well.

When starting a work from home business, it is not advisable to take out a loan. Relationships are ruined when money is involved. Is your home not important to you that you could risk it as collateral?

Be sure to gives customers notice of any item that is sold out. One thing that really frustrates customers is discovering the fact that their ordered products aren't going to show up for weeks or longer. If an item will be back ordered, give your customers options; either let them choose another product or refund their money.

Use your business plan as a road map leading to your success. Think about crafting one regardless of whether you intend to seek investors or other types of funding. Business plans are useful because they allow you to organize your goals, strategy, and deadlines.

Choose a name with meaning. The name of your brand will be associated with your products: choose a name that people will recognize and remember. You can choose a name which carries a funny or enlightening story with it. Customers will come back to buy more from you and develop loyalty.

It is important to minimize costs when you first begin your home based business. When your work location is your own home, you will not have any rental costs for a separate business location. Only buy necessary items to keep your expenses low. Using a budget for your expenses helps keep the costs of your products cheap.

Always make sure that you have extensive documentation tracking the daily costs and expenditures of your online business. If you keep excellent records now, when it comes time to pay your taxes you will not spend days on end looking for the proper receipts. Excellent records will also help if you get audited.

It is important to determine what the going rate is for your product or service. You should so this prior to marketing and selling. Look at your competition, and aim to offer more competitive prices. Talking negatively about another business is bad for your own, so focus on making your good qualities stand out instead.

Offer multiple ways for customers to contact you, including email, telephone and even traditional mail. A list of products purchased after questions have been answered should be kept. There is the possibility that their purchase was a result of your answers, and you can learn to reproduce the same results with each curious visitor.

When starting up a work from home business, be certain to calculate the start up costs. Your costs may be lower than a traditional business, but they still must be accounted for. Determining your expenses in advance will aid you in keeping your business running in the black.

Home based business forums can be a great resource for new information. You can interact and relate to other people in the same situation this way. Many home business owners have the same problems and it is good to have people to share concerns with.

Go to some forums or message boards for work from home business owners. Do your research to find out which sites are the most reputable. In addition to forums, you may find great information in a number of blogs.
